V4L2_PIX_FMT_NV12M
.v4l2 = V4L2_PIX_FMT_NV12M,
.v4l2 = V4L2_PIX_FMT_NV12M,
case V4L2_PIX_FMT_NV12M:
case V4L2_PIX_FMT_NV12M:
case V4L2_PIX_FMT_NV12M:
.fourcc = V4L2_PIX_FMT_NV12M,
cap->format.pix_mp.pixelformat = V4L2_PIX_FMT_NV12M;
f.fmt.pix_mp.pixelformat = V4L2_PIX_FMT_NV12M;
.pixfmt = V4L2_PIX_FMT_NV12M,
.sibling = V4L2_PIX_FMT_NV12M,
case V4L2_PIX_FMT_NV12M:
params->input_format != V4L2_PIX_FMT_NV12M)
.fourcc = V4L2_PIX_FMT_NV12M,
inst->dst_fmt.pixelformat == V4L2_PIX_FMT_NV12M) {
.v4l2_pix_fmt = V4L2_PIX_FMT_NV12M,
.v4l2_pix_fmt = V4L2_PIX_FMT_NV12M,
.fourcc = V4L2_PIX_FMT_NV12M,
.fourcc = V4L2_PIX_FMT_NV12M,
if (enc_format == V4L2_PIX_FMT_NV12M ||
if (enc_format == V4L2_PIX_FMT_NV12M ||
.pixelformat = V4L2_PIX_FMT_NV12M,
case V4L2_PIX_FMT_NV12M:
.pixelformat = V4L2_PIX_FMT_NV12M,
.pixelformat = V4L2_PIX_FMT_NV12M,
case V4L2_PIX_FMT_NV12M:
.fourcc = V4L2_PIX_FMT_NV12M,
.fourcc = V4L2_PIX_FMT_NV12M,
case V4L2_PIX_FMT_NV12M:
case V4L2_PIX_FMT_NV12M:
.fourcc = V4L2_PIX_FMT_NV12M,
case V4L2_PIX_FMT_NV12M:
.fourcc = V4L2_PIX_FMT_NV12M,
.fourcc = V4L2_PIX_FMT_NV12M,
{ V4L2_PIX_FMT_NV12M, { 8, 16, 0 }, 2, 2, 2, 0x42, false, false,
{ V4L2_PIX_FMT_NV12M, V4L2_COLORSPACE_SRGB,
#define JPU_JPEG_DEFAULT_420_PIX_FMT V4L2_PIX_FMT_NV12M
{ V4L2_PIX_FMT_NV12M, MEDIA_BUS_FMT_AYUV8_1X32,
.fourcc = V4L2_PIX_FMT_NV12M,
.fourcc = V4L2_PIX_FMT_NV12M,
.fourcc = V4L2_PIX_FMT_NV12M,
.fourcc = V4L2_PIX_FMT_NV12M,
.pixelformat = V4L2_PIX_FMT_NV12M,
.fourcc = V4L2_PIX_FMT_NV12M,
f.fmt.pix_mp.pixelformat = V4L2_PIX_FMT_NV12M;
.fourcc = V4L2_PIX_FMT_NV12M,
#define DEF_SRC_FMT_ENC V4L2_PIX_FMT_NV12M
.fourcc = V4L2_PIX_FMT_NV12M,
if (ctx->src_fmt->fourcc == V4L2_PIX_FMT_NV12M)
if (ctx->src_fmt->fourcc == V4L2_PIX_FMT_NV12M) {
if (ctx->src_fmt->fourcc == V4L2_PIX_FMT_NV12M)
case V4L2_PIX_FMT_NV12M:
case V4L2_PIX_FMT_NV12M:
if (ctx->src_fmt->fourcc == V4L2_PIX_FMT_NV12M) {
.fourcc = V4L2_PIX_FMT_NV12M,
.fourcc = V4L2_PIX_FMT_NV12M,
.fourcc = V4L2_PIX_FMT_NV12M,
{ .format = V4L2_PIX_FMT_NV12M, .pixel_enc = V4L2_PIXEL_ENC_YUV, .mem_planes = 2, .comp_planes = 2, .bpp = { 1, 2, 0, 0 }, .bpp_div = { 1, 1, 1, 1 }, .hdiv = 2, .vdiv = 2 },
case V4L2_PIX_FMT_NV12M: descr = "Y/UV 4:2:0 (N-C)"; break;
if (sess->pixfmt_cap == V4L2_PIX_FMT_NV12M)
if (sess->pixfmt_cap == V4L2_PIX_FMT_NV12M) {
if (sess->pixfmt_cap == V4L2_PIX_FMT_NV12M)
case V4L2_PIX_FMT_NV12M:
case V4L2_PIX_FMT_NV12M:
if (pixmp->pixelformat == V4L2_PIX_FMT_NV12M) {
if (sess->pixfmt_cap == V4L2_PIX_FMT_NV12M)
case V4L2_PIX_FMT_NV12M:
case V4L2_PIX_FMT_NV12M:
.pixfmts_cap = { V4L2_PIX_FMT_NV12M, 0 },
.pixfmts_cap = { V4L2_PIX_FMT_NV12M, V4L2_PIX_FMT_YUV420M, 0 },
.pixfmts_cap = { V4L2_PIX_FMT_NV12M, V4L2_PIX_FMT_YUV420M, 0 },
.pixfmts_cap = { V4L2_PIX_FMT_NV12M, 0 },
.pixfmts_cap = { V4L2_PIX_FMT_NV12M, 0 },
.pixfmts_cap = { V4L2_PIX_FMT_NV12M, V4L2_PIX_FMT_YUV420M, 0 },
.pixfmts_cap = { V4L2_PIX_FMT_NV12M, V4L2_PIX_FMT_YUV420M, 0 },
.pixfmts_cap = { V4L2_PIX_FMT_NV12M, 0 },
.pixfmts_cap = { V4L2_PIX_FMT_NV12M, 0 },
.pixfmts_cap = { V4L2_PIX_FMT_NV12M, V4L2_PIX_FMT_YUV420M, 0 },
.pixfmts_cap = { V4L2_PIX_FMT_NV12M, V4L2_PIX_FMT_YUV420M, 0 },
.pixfmts_cap = { V4L2_PIX_FMT_NV12M, 0 },
.pixfmts_cap = { V4L2_PIX_FMT_NV12M, 0 },
.pixfmts_cap = { V4L2_PIX_FMT_NV12M, 0 },
.pixfmts_cap = { V4L2_PIX_FMT_NV12M, V4L2_PIX_FMT_YUV420M, 0 },
.pixfmts_cap = { V4L2_PIX_FMT_NV12M, V4L2_PIX_FMT_YUV420M, 0 },
.pixfmts_cap = { V4L2_PIX_FMT_NV12M, V4L2_PIX_FMT_YUV420M, 0 },
.pixfmts_cap = { V4L2_PIX_FMT_NV12M, V4L2_PIX_FMT_YUV420M, 0 },
.pixfmts_cap = { V4L2_PIX_FMT_NV12M, 0 },
.pixfmts_cap = { V4L2_PIX_FMT_NV12M, 0 },
.pixfmts_cap = { V4L2_PIX_FMT_NV12M, V4L2_PIX_FMT_YUV420M, 0 },
.pixfmts_cap = { V4L2_PIX_FMT_NV12M, V4L2_PIX_FMT_YUV420M, 0 },